Abstract

The invention provides a simple and easy wind force test device and relates to a weather detection device. The simple and easy wind force test device comprises a horizontal support, a vertical rod, a wind scoop and a ruler, wherein the vertical rod is connected with the support through a bearing, the vertical rod can rotate horizontally, the wind scoop is connected with the vertical rod by an extension spring, the ruler is fixedly connected with the vertical rod, and a horizontal slideway is arranged on the upper section of the ruler. A small pulley is arranged at the tail end of the wind scoop, the wind scoop is connected with the ruler by the small pulley of the slideway in a horizontal and sliding mode, scales are arranged on the ruler, a wind direction indicating flag is arranged on the top of the vertical rod, wind force pushes the wind scoop to overcome the acting force of the extension spring, and the small pulley slides along the ruler and designates corresponding scale value to obtain reference measurement results. Compared with an existing large-scale detecting instrument, the simple and easy wind force test device is simple in structure, low in cost and convenient to operate.
